Bristol City Council, a sub-central government public authority, is the buying organisation for a procurement process titled "Social Care or Education Placement". The tender falls within the services industry category, specifically health and social work services. The procurement followed a direct method below the competition threshold under the light-touch regime.
The award stage is complete, with a contract signed on 31st August 2025. 81, commenced on 1st September 2025 and will conclude on 31st July 2026. The services will be delivered in the South West of England, region UKK1.
